Fingerprints Recognition Using the Local Energy Distribution over Haar Wavelet Subbands
Zainab J. Ahmed | Loay E. George [6]
Abstract: Fingerprints are commonly utilized as a key technique and for personal recognition and in identification systems for personal security affairs. The most widely used fingerprint systems utilizing the distribution of minutiae points for fingerprint matching and representation. These techniques become unsuccessful when partial fingerprint images are capture, or the finger ridges suffer from lot of cuts or injuries or skin sickness. This paper suggests a fingerprint recognition technique which utilizes the local features for fingerprint representation and matching. The adopted local features have determined using Haar wavelet subbands. The system was tested experimentally using FVC2004 databases, which consists of four datasets, each set holds 80 fingers with 8 samples per finger. The attained test results showed encouraging system capability to recognize low quality fingerprint images although with presence of partial loss in fingerprint images.
